Donald Trump told one of his aides after the 2020 presidential election loss, “I’m just not going to leave.” The New York Times reporter Maggie Haberman exposed his comment in an upcoming book. Representative Liz Cheney (R-WY) will appear in a CNN special where she said that attitude only “affirms the reality of the danger” that is Trump.

Cheney, who is vice-chair of the House January 6 Select Committee, appeared with CNN co-anchor Jake Tapper as part of its documentary American Coup: The January 6 Investigation. It will air Sunday. The representative remarked during her interview with Tapper:

“And when you hear something like that, I think you have to recognize that we were in no man’s land and territory we’d never been in before as a nation.’

Haberman wrote in her book Confidence Man: The Making of Donald Trump and the Breaking of America published by Penguin Random House, Trump insisted he would not leave the White House after President Joe Biden’s inauguration:

‘I’m just not going to leave. We’re never leaving. How can you leave when you won an election?’

Cheney was by then used to Trump’s dictatorial bent. But she said his words made people believe the situation “wasn’t as dangerous as it really was:”

‘And if you have a president who’s refusing to leave the White House, or who’s saying he refuses to leave the White House, then anyone who sort of stands aside and says someone else will handle it is themselves putting the nation at risk, because it’s clear that, when you’re at a moment that we faced, everyone’s got to stand up and take responsibility.’

Words mattered, according to Cheney:

‘It’s not surprising that those are the sentiments that he reportedly expressed. I think, again, it just affirms — affirms the reality of the danger.’
